When it comes to slide outs, they work great until they get old. How old? The earliest ones were big trouble, but they have come a long way over the years. Still, I think most advocates of slide outs are people who sell their rigs before any trouble begins.
If buying a used rig, I would value input from slide out owners of rigs between 15 and 25 years old. If you are buying a rig with a slide out that is a model year 2000 and plan to keep it 10 years, then you will be one of those people.
